How to distinguish the quality of coffee beans?

Coffee is one of the most popular drinks in the world, and the quality of coffee beans directly affects the taste and flavor of coffee. So, how to distinguish the quality of coffee beans? The following will introduce the appearance, smell and taste.


First of all, appearance is the first indicator of the quality of coffee beans. Good coffee beans should be shiny and have a smooth surface. If you find a lot of cracks or bumps, it means that these beans may not be fresh enough or there are problems in the processing. In addition, good coffee beans usually have a uniform and dark appearance, rather than obvious color differences or spots.


Secondly, when evaluating the quality of coffee beans, you need to pay attention to the smell. Freshness is one of the most important factors in measuring the smell. Good coffee should have a rich and fragrant aroma without any peculiar or musty smell. In addition, when smelling, you can also pay attention to whether you can distinguish various complex and pleasant aromas, such as chocolate, nuts or fruits.

Finally, taste is the key to judging the quality of coffee beans. Good coffee should have a balanced and rich taste. A cup of high-quality coffee should give you a rich and full taste experience without being too bitter or too acidic. In addition, good coffee should have a soft and smooth taste and emit a long-lasting and pleasant aftertaste when it stays on the tip of the tongue.

In short, when distinguishing the quality of coffee beans, you need to consider the appearance, smell and taste. The quality can be judged by carefully observing whether the surface of the beans is smooth and shiny, whether it emits a fragrant aroma when smelling, and whether it is balanced, rich and pleasant when tasting. Of course, when buying coffee beans, you can also refer to the recommendations of professionals or brands to ensure that you buy high-quality products that suit your taste preferences.
